Stefan Schmidt [Wed, 29 Oct 2014 14:51:11 +0000 (15:51 +0100)]
eina_file: Give TMPDIR presedence over XDG_RUNTIME_DIR when defined
XDG_RUNTIME_DIR gives us a nice securty benefit by only allowing the
same user to read wand write files.
In some configuration this is problematic though. If one looks at the
bug report this fixes for example you can see that there are build
scripts that use a special build user.
The way this has always worked on unix is that you can define your
own tempdir with TMPDIR. When I was making the original change towards
XDG_RUNTIME_DIR I expected some trouble with it but it worked quite
well so far.
To avoid breaking scripts out there and maybe configurations we
haven't tested yet give TMPDIR precedence over XDG_RUNTIME_DIR.
Fixes T1766

Stefan Schmidt [Mon, 27 Oct 2014 14:47:51 +0000 (15:47 +0100)]
eina: Fix _timedwait to handle the given timeout on top of the absolute time
The pthread man page clearly states that pthread_cond_timedwait() takes an
absolute time parameter. So far we always passed it epoch plus timeout in
seconds. This would never trigger the timeout.
Making sure we fill out timespec struct with the current time before adding
the timeout as offset now. Also handling the t < 0 error case.
Various version worked up together with Jean-Philippe Andre <jp.andre@samsung.com>
This version does not use _eina_time_get directly as this is currently not a
public API of eina. If we decide to make _eina_time_get public we can remove the
extra code here.
Fixes T1701

Adrien Nader [Sat, 25 Oct 2014 14:35:06 +0000 (16:35 +0200)]
ecore_exe_win32: CreateProcess was called with random flags.
CreateProcess() has a flags parameter which is being passed
"run_pri | CREATE_SUSPENDED".
The issue lies in the value of run_pri. It is best explained by the
following code somewhere else in the file:
switch (run_pri)
{
case IDLE_PRIORITY_CLASS:
return ECORE_EXE_WIN32_PRIORITY_IDLE;
The run_pri variable is supposed to store a value from the win32 API while
it was used to store one from the ecore API.
If I recall correctly, the windows one is equal to 32 and the ecore one to
9999. Meaning 9999 ended up used as flags so let's have a look at what that
actually enabled; the reference is "Process Creation Flags" from MSDN
http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/ms684863%28v=vs.85%29.aspx .
9999 gives 0x0000270F and this matches
DEBUG_PROCESS | DETACHED_PROCESS | DEBUG_ONLY_THIS_PROCESS
| CREATE_SUSPENDED | CREATE_NEW_PROCESS_GROUP | CREATE_SEPARATE_WOW_VDM
| CREATE_UNICODE_ENVIRONMENT | <0x00002000 matches nothing>
Matches nothing? Weird. Well, maybe. Except that I stumbled upon this define
in the mingw-w64 headers:
#define CREATE_FORCEDOS 0x2000
Mingw-w64 only has a #define, Wine has nothing (they don't do DOS anyway),
but ReactOS has some code about it:
https://git.reactos.org/?p=reactos.git;a=blob;f=reactos/dll/win32/kernel32/client/proc.c;hb=
f60941f8dc775427af04eb0a3c3e4d38160c7641#l3007
Overall the actual set of flags probably made very little sense and wasn't
working very well. :)
I also noticed the following in the mingw-w64 headers:
#define INHERIT_CALLER_PRIORITY 0x20000
This should be a better match for what seemed to be the original intent of
inheriting the priority. I haven't tested it and it's only documented on
MSDN for Windows CE and similar so I'm really not sure about what it does.
MSDN however mentions that the child processes will have at most the
"normal" priority by default (same as its parent if the parent has less
than the default one) but I'm under the impression a process can raise its
own priority level... Anyway, "NORMAL_PRIORITY_CLASS" will do for now.
With this change and a couple others, elementary's theme builds properly
on Windows (_on_ Windows). I'll assess the usefulness of the other changes
in my tree over the next few days.
